  • We've Made History Again!!

    The Dirty Heads are not only the first independent label artists to have a #1 song at alternative radio for 10 weeks in a row but the laid back group out of Orange County is also the first independent label artists to go #1 on Billboard's all format rock songs chart in history! The song that has taken the group to new limits is "Lay Me Down" featuring Rome of Sublime with Rome.

    The Dirty Heads seem to be everywhere these days from a featured artist spot on Fuel TV, their songs have been featured in the movie and soundtrack for Surf’s Up and famous actor Matthew McConaughey selected the band’s music to be in his film, Surfer Dude. In addition, the Dirty Heads can be heard in Tony Hawk’s Downhill Jam video game and have been included in a number of marketing campaigns for Etnies Jeans, Vestal Watches, Hurley, Skullcandy and more.

    No matter how popular these guys get, frontman Jared Watson says “We just want to make you feel good.”
